Scottish Champion Hurdle Tips 2025 – Nicholls To Down Mullins In Ayr Grade 2

There’s a stunning day of top quality National Hunt action at Ayr on Saturday afternoon with the Scottish Grand National the feature race. However, there’s a hugely competitive renewal of the Scottish Champion Hurdle at 2:15pm and our in-house tipster Steve Chambers previews the contest and picks out his 1-2-3 for the event.

ETHICAL DIAMOND

(Patrick Mullins/Willie Mullins)

Fourth in the Duke Of Edinburgh Stakes at Royal Ascot back in June, Ethical Diamond showed he would be a top notch dual performer when he landed victory in a Punchestown maiden hurdle in February. Well fancied for the Country Hurdle at last month’s Cheltenham Festival, the Willie Mullins-trained raider put up a fine effort to finish fourth in that event and he’s likely to go close again here. He was given a 1lb rise for that run last month, so he will need to improve again to land the spoils off a mark of 144, and off top weight it’s going to be a test, but he’s a class act and is the one to beat.

KABRAL DU MATHAN

(Harry Cobden/Paul Nicholls)

One of the shining lights of the Paul Nicholls yard this season, Kabral Du Mathan kicked off his career with three wins out of three over hurdles. The five-year-old was narrowly touched off in a red-hot Kempton handicap hurdle back in Friday, while he then ran another fine race to finish second to Secret Squirrel at Windsor at the end of January. He bypassed Cheltenham last month, which could be a big blessing in disguise as he will head to Ayr a fresh horse and off the same mark of 139 he has to be a major player. Sure to run a solid race, he could be capable of continuing his progression over timber and is entitled to be at the forefront of the betting.

VALGRAND

(Harry Skelton/Dan Skelton)

Hugely impressive when running away with a Cheltenham race back in October, Valgrand has failed to get his head in front on his last five outings, but he’s one that could relish the quicker ground at Ayr and is a leading player for the Skelton team. He was well fancied for the County Hurdle at Cheltenham last month, but ran no sort of race at all when finishing 15th of 16, so he’s definitely on a comeback mission here. The handicapper has given him a chance having dropped him 2lbs to a mark of 132, but he will need to recapture his early season form to figure in the finish.

THE FIELD

A really smart novice hurdler, Dysart Enos has struggled outside of that company, but Fergal O’Brien still holds the mare in high regard and she’s entitled to take her chance here. A distant eighth in the Mares’ Hurdle at Cheltenham, she’s one that will relish a return to the handicap sphere and is of interest. Bunting was heavily backed in the lead-up to the County Hurdle, but the Mullins-trained five-year-old was far too keen and was pulled-up. He still possesses a lot of ability, but he will need to settle to stand any chance here. Adrian Keatley’s Kihavah has an excellent recent record at Ayr having won on his last two outings at the Scottish track, so has to be given a second look, while Nicky Henderson’s Under Control and Alastair Ralph’s bottom weight Welsh Charger add more depth to the contest.


VERDICT

It’s a fascinating renewal of the Scottish Champion Hurdle and it’s a clash of yesteryear with Willie Mullins and Paul Nicholls locking horns. While all eyes will be on the Mullins battalion it’s KABRAL DU MATHAN that can continue his improvement over hurdles and get the better of Ethical Diamond with Kihavah running another fine race at Ayr and finishing third.
